Hello Traders,

You should know that starting today (June 28th, 2021), the CME and CBOT will eliminate the 3:15 p.m. – 3:30 p.m. Central Time (CT) trading halt on CME Globex which currently exists for certain Equity futures and options contracts.

This means that the session will run all the way through to 4 PM CT session close. This might take some traders by surprise.

Correct. Settlement is at 15:00:00 CT based on the 30 seconds ending at that time. Session still ends at 4 PM CT.
